    I love the Rainbow Six games; specifically the planning aspect of the game. Beginners will often just treat the game like a normal first person shooter, but the planning is the most rewarding aspect.

    Instead of running around aimlessly, you can have four seperate teams complete different objectives and then storm a room with hostages from different entrances at your command. One of my favorite missions from an older Rainbow Six was putting a sniper in a balcony of a room with hostages (a theater), and then having 3 teams storm in simultaneously with the sniper taking out the person pointing the gun to the hostage's head.

    this planning mode is not in the Vegas version... so that sucks.
